Ed Sheeran + Burna Boy Share ‘For My Hand’ Video: Look + Listen

In the new video for the Nigerian pop star’s single, “For My Hand,” Burna Boy enlists the support of superstar singer/songwriter Ed Sheeran to take an elevator ride to the stars.

The video clip for the song is from Burna’s just-released sixth album, Love, Damini, and opens with the crooner hopping into the lift whose buttons contain both the singer’s names and the title of the song.

Switching between images of Sheeran and Burna (born Damini Ogulu) in the elevator and a couple performing a sensual dance as the doors open and close, the video transports the English pop star to a stone slab adrift in the ocean as he sings, “Hear my love is burning baby feels like time is frozen babe/ The night is for us I feel alone again/ Every moment is calling ye/ Feelings I been holding in/ It must be love.” And Burna, floating amidst the clouds, accompanies Sheeran on the lyrics, “Wherever you are girl that’s where I call my home/ Whenever you down here I’ll be letting you know.”

About the intimate title of his 19-track album, Burna told Billboard “That’s how I like to sign all my letters, because I didn’t know the proper [signoff].” “It’s a bit personal [because] it’s bringing you into my head on my birthday — when you turn 31 and ain’t got no kids, everything is going good and bad at the same time. You reflect and then you get as lit as possible. Then you sleep and wake up and reflect again. I’m reflecting on everything — what I’m doing and what’s happening where I’m from. Where I’m from is a part of where I’m going.”

In addition to Sheeran, the collection features collaborations with Kehlani, Khalid, Popcaan, J. Balvin, Blxst, J Hus, Ladysmith Black Mambazo and Victony.
